I wasn't able to watch the combine live i just saw it on my DVR and Verrett looked really impressive ran a good 40 did excellent in all the drills looked very competitive while out there. Got a lot of praise from Mayok and praise from Deion summary from the combine is what every one keeps saying excellent corner but short. The only concern mentioned was he might get beat on jump balls. But other than that he looks solid he looks like a perfect corner for the slot in today's NFL that can be huge. And would be a huge upgrade from our current slot DB Rodgers.

"His bench-press showing is all the more impressive given that he is dealing with a labrum (shoulder) injury that will be surgically repaired later this month. The procedure typically requires three or four months of rehabilitation, which means that Verrett (5-9, 189) will miss the minicamps and OTAs of the team that drafts him, but that he will be back for training camp."
